EDI Control

 

  • Positive
    The EDI control uses an absolute positioning, dual sensor pickup that uniquely identifies each spout position. No “counting from home” is required. 
  • Trouble free
    Each spout is driven by a variable torque clutched drive system that protects the distributor and drive system from damage in case of jammed spouts. The unique drive system never needs adjustment. 
  • Fast positioning
    After initial installation the controls do an automatic, one-time, self-teach routine to learn the characteristics of the distributor to which it is connected. The spout then rotates using the “shortest path” to the desired outlet. 
  • Run it your way
    The operator may field assign bin numbers and names to all positions and use “speed dial” buttons for up to six positions. Additionally, the keypad-display terminal can be mounted remotely from the control panel, in a more convenient location for the operator.
  • Competitive
    In most cases the complete system, installed and wired, is less expensive than a comparable limit switch system.
